首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

克隆github存储库,然后将其上传到我自己的存储库

克隆GitHub存储库是指将远程GitHub上的代码仓库完整地复制到本地计算机上。这样可以方便地获取代码并进行修改、测试和开发。以下是完善且全面的答案:

概念:

克隆GitHub存储库是通过Git工具将远程GitHub上的代码仓库复制到本地计算机上的过程。Git是一种分布式版本控制系统,它可以跟踪文件的修改历史并协调多个开发者之间的工作。

分类:

克隆GitHub存储库可以分为两种方式:HTTPS和SSH。HTTPS方式使用HTTPS协议进行通信,适用于无需频繁进行代码提交和推送的场景。SSH方式使用SSH协议进行通信,适用于需要频繁进行代码提交和推送的场景。

优势:

  1. 方便获取代码:克隆GitHub存储库可以快速获取远程代码,并在本地进行修改和开发。
  2. 版本控制:Git可以跟踪文件的修改历史,方便回溯和管理代码版本。
  3. 多人协作:多个开发者可以通过克隆GitHub存储库来协同开发,每个人可以在本地进行修改和测试,然后将修改推送到远程仓库。

应用场景:

克隆GitHub存储库适用于以下场景:

  1. 开源项目:开发者可以克隆GitHub上的开源项目,进行本地修改和测试,然后向项目贡献自己的代码。
  2. 团队协作:团队成员可以克隆共享的GitHub存储库,进行本地开发和测试,然后将修改推送到远程仓库,实现团队协作开发。
  3. 个人项目:个人开发者可以使用GitHub作为代码托管平台,克隆自己的存储库到不同的设备上进行开发和备份。

推荐的腾讯云相关产品和产品介绍链接地址:

腾讯云提供了多个与代码托管和版本控制相关的产品和服务,以下是其中几个推荐的产品:

  1. 代码托管服务:腾讯云代码托管服务(CodeCommit)是一种安全、可扩展的托管服务,支持Git协议,可以方便地托管和管理代码仓库。产品介绍链接:https://cloud.tencent.com/product/ccs
  2. 代码托管平台:腾讯云开发者平台(Coding)是一种面向开发者的综合性开发平台,提供代码托管、项目管理、团队协作等功能。产品介绍链接:https://cloud.tencent.com/product/coding
  3. 云原生开发平台:腾讯云云原生开发平台(TKE)是一种基于Kubernetes的容器化应用托管平台,可以方便地部署和管理容器化应用。产品介绍链接:https://cloud.tencent.com/product/tke

通过使用腾讯云的代码托管服务和开发平台,您可以方便地托管和管理代码仓库,并进行团队协作和云原生开发。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

43秒

Quivr非结构化信息搜索

16分8秒

Tspider分库分表的部署 - MySQL

14分30秒

Percona pt-archiver重构版--大表数据归档工具

领券